Output ce7593204d262083dd06327b89c3b854201c491143a1d6b5ccf7c892c1afb937:8

value
616620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f620ff46369c45ede4bf0a247e7a1f33a12fcf OP_EQUAL
address
3LU3JCoy2vbD79qh1a8NvW7AYmoEJ6Ao8c
transaction
ce7593204d262083dd06327b89c3b854201c491143a1d6b5ccf7c892c1afb937
spent
false